Old Tom Gin Cocktail

Serve in a Nick & Nora glass

Ingredients:
2 oz Hayman's Old Tom Gin
0.08 oz Gomme syrup
0.04 oz Orange Curaçao liqueur
2 dash Boker's bitters
× 1 1 serving
Read about cocktail measures and measuring

How to make:

  1. Select and pre-chill a Nick & Nora glass.
  2. Prepare garnish of lemon zest twist.
  3. STIR all ingredients with ice.
  4. STRAIN into ice-filled glass.
  5. EXPRESS lemon zest twist over the cocktail and use as garnish.

History:

Adapted from a recipe in Jerry Thomas' 1887 Bar-Tender's Guide.

Gin Cocktail.
(Use small bar glass.)
Take 3 or 4 dashes of gum syrup.
2 dashes of bitters (Boker's).
1 wine-glass of Holland gin.
1 or 2 dashes of Curaçao.
Fill the glass one-third full of shaved ice, and strain into a cocktail glass. Twist a small piece of lemon peel, place it in the glass, and serve.

Old Tom Gin Cocktail.
Same as the foregoing, substituting Old Tom, instead of Holland Gin.

Jerry Thomas, Bar-Tender's Guide, 1887
